- Abstract
Such see-through solar technology not only provides a solution to convert ambient light (sunlight or indoor lights) to electricity, but also offers the realization of self-sustainable power. B Transparent Photovoltaics b In article number 2000564, Shun-Wei Liu and co-workers demonstrated vacuum-deposited transparent photovoltaics with a power conversion efficiency of 1.34%, average visible transmission of 77.45%, and a color rendering index of 91.9.
